Abstract
Purpose of the study: to assess the incidence and clinical features of drug-induced anaphylactic shock to beta-lactam antibiotics, errors in its diagnosis and treatment in military medical organizations using the example of the Eastern Military District. An analysis of 190 case histories over a 9-year period (2014–2022) showed that complications to antibacterial drugs accounted for 46.6% of the total number of drug allergy cases, and anaphylactic shock in 5.7% of cases. More often, shock developed with the use of beta-lactam antibiotics. A number of main problems have been identified: the formal collection of an allergic history in patients with respiratory infections, the widespread, often unreasonable use of antibiotics for intravenous administration in respiratory viral infections, the weak alertness of clinicians in the development of anaphylaxis when prescribing drugs. Failures in the treatment of shock in most cases are associated with the late introduction of epinephrine or the use of its low doses, delayed resuscitation. Recommended anti-shock kit for procedural, dental rooms.
